To understand how the fake family scheme works, it is necessary to first understand the role of a GDS. Platforms like Amadeus, Sabre, and Travelport process millions of data transmissions daily. When a travel agent searches for a flight, the GDS fetches real-time seat availability and pricing from the airline’s database.

The term "family" in "fake family" also connects directly to "fare families"—a pricing structure airlines use to unbundle services into different fare tiers (such as Basic, Go, and Full fare families). Fraudsters exploit these fare families by creating fake family group bookings to access lower group rates or to circumvent fare restrictions. Volotea, for instance, has implemented a fare families structure within GDS that includes three distinct fare types, each with its own modification penalties and conditions. Fraudsters may attempt to book multiple passengers under a "family" designation to qualify for group discounts, then cancel or modify individual names after ticketing—a classic arbitrage technique that results in significant revenue leakage for airlines. Motivations and Origins People construct fake families online for a variety of motives. Some seek social validation: a polished family image can attract likes, followers, sponsorships, or entry into influencer economies. Others pursue escapism — crafting an alternate reality that compensates for loneliness, real-life dysfunction, or social stigma. In certain contexts, fake family personas may be used strategically: to manipulate public opinion, to launder reputations, or to create believable backstories for scams, catfishing, or social experiments. Platforms that reward visual storytelling and interpersonal drama implicitly encourage these fabrications by monetizing engagement.
